Transaction 7359475caf7eab1c34c1169340dc38274d89a648e98158aa54f70ff9302b9a14

1 Input
2 Outputs
  • 7359475caf7eab1c34c1169340dc38274d89a648e98158aa54f70ff9302b9a14:0
  • value  1256215
    address  36uF4GLXgDfbHYCGPedQdz5dyZGqbUgz31
  • 7359475caf7eab1c34c1169340dc38274d89a648e98158aa54f70ff9302b9a14:1
  • value  107506
    address  36YiJpH32d1Cg4HEeQ38GW91mReC1c63iz